The structure of young stands in different forest associations was studied at 134 sample plots in the protected area in the mountainous forest of Arasbaran (Iran). While the most mixed broad-leaved stands showed coppice with standards character, the juniper high stands showed a peculiar structure with trees arranged in clusters.
